Bertie, (Lord) Montagu Peregrine Albemarle. Adm. pens. (age 20) at MAGDALENE, July 28, 1881. S. and h. of Montagu Peregrine, Earl of Lindsey, of Uffington House, Stamford. B. Sept. 3, 1861. School, Eton. Matric. Michs. 1881. Styled Lord Bertie, 1877-99. Late Capt., 4th Batt. Lancs. Regt. A.D.C. to Lord Carrington, Governor of New South Wales, Australia, 1885-8. Succeeded his father as 12th Earl of Lindsey, Jan. 29, 1899. J.P. and D.L. for Lincs. Married and had issue. Died s.p.m. Jan. 2, 1938, aged 76, in London. (Burke, P. and B., ed. 1937, sub Lindsey; The Times, Jan. 3, 1938.) | Lord Montagu Peregrine Albemarle BERTIE Approx. lifespan: 18611938 Adm pens. aged 20 Magdalene College 1881:07:28 s. and h. of Lord Montagu Peregrine BERTIE, Earl of Lindsey of Uffington House, [Uffington, Stamford], [Lincolnshire], b. 1861:09:03 Sch: Eton Matric 1881:10MT: Styled Lord BERTIE 1877-99 Late Captain: 4th Battalion Lancs.
